Choosing Materials That Stand Up to Essential Oils
Not all materials are created equal when it comes to volatile organic compounds found in essential oils. Plastic spoons may degrade, leach chemicals, or absorb lingering scents, which ruins the purity of subsequent experiments. Stainless steel is the gold standard because it is non-porous and non-reactive.
Always prioritize high-grade, food-safe stainless steel for a scent-making kit. While it requires a slightly higher initial investment, it prevents the need for constant replacements and ensures that fragrance profiles remain untainted. Cleaning and Storage Tips for a Shared Workspace
Hygiene in a home lab prevents cross-contamination of delicate fragrance notes. Stainless steel tools should be cleaned with a mild, scent-free dish soap immediately after use to ensure that no oil residue remains. A small drying rack or a designated “perfumery basket” helps keep these specialized tools separate from general kitchen utensils.
